House underpinning services involve strengthening or stabilizing a building's foundation to ensure its long-term stability. This process typically includes excavating beneath the existing foundation and installing new support structures, such as piers or piles, to transfer the building’s weight to more stable soil or bedrock. Underpinning is often necessary when a property experiences signs of foundation movement, such as cracking wal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er open properly. By reinforcing the foundation, homeowners can help prevent further structural issues and protect their property investment.

These services are essential for addressing a variety of foundation problems that can develop over time. Soil settling, erosion, or changes in moisture levels can cause the foundation to shift or sink, leading to structural damage. In some cases, previous construction or nearby excavation work may have compromised the stability of a property’s foundation. Underpinning helps to correct these issues by providing additional support where it’s needed most. It is a practical solution for homes experiencing subsidence, cracking, or unevenness that could otherwise worsen if left unaddressed.

Properties that typically require underpinning services include older homes, especially those built on problematic soil types such as clay or loose fill. Commercial buildings, extensions, or properties that have undergone significant renovations may also need foundation reinforcement to ensure safety and stability. What is house underpinning? House underpinning involves strengthening or stabilizing a building’s foundation to address issues like settling or structural movement.

When should a home need underpinning services? Underpinning may be needed if a house shows signs of foundation movement, such as c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ors that don’t close properly.

What types of underpinning methods are available? Local contractors may use various methods, including pier and beam underpinning, underpinning with concrete piers, or underpinning with steel piles, depending on the situation.

How do professionals assess if underpinning is necessary? Service providers typically evaluate the foundation’s condition through inspections and structural assessments to determine if underpinning is appropriate.

Can underpinning be combined with other foundation repairs? Yes, underpinning can often be integrated with additional foundation repairs to ensure overall stability and safety of the home.
